GPC Hedge Fund Activity: Q3 2020 in Review
800 of the 4,956 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in Genuine Parts (GPC) for Q3 2020, worth a combined $10.7B — up 10% from $9.73B a quarter earlier.
Buyers outnumbered sellers: 82 funds opened new GPC positions and 51 closed out — a net gain of 31 holders — while 265 added to existing stakes and 287 trimmed.
The largest buyer was BlackRock, adding an estimated $93.8M. The largest seller was Caisse de Depot et Placement du Quebec (CDPQ), cutting an estimated $71.6M.
